#c77b86 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c77b86 is composed of 78% red, 48.2%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.2% magenta, 32.7%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 351.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 63.1%. #c77b86 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#8f000d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#c77b86

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060203 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c77b86

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39fa0 is the less saturated color, while #fa4862 is the most saturated one.
